Released by Siemens PLM Software, NX 7.5 introduced significant advancements in Synchronous Technology, which allowed engineers to edit parametric models without historical data. It bridged the gap between history-based and history-free modeling.

Unigraphics NX 7.5, released in 2011, was a significant version of the software, offering advanced capabilities for design, simulation, and manufacturing. It included improvements in CAD design, enhanced simulation tools, and more integrated CAM functionalities. This version was particularly noted for its user interface improvements, enhanced performance, and new features that facilitated more efficient workflows.
